Primary Alkaline Batteries Sales Market Outlook

The global primary alkaline batteries market was valued at approximately USD 4.5 billion in 2023 and is projected to reach around USD 6.5 billion by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 4.2% during the forecast period of 2025 to 2035. This growth is largely driven by the increasing demand for portable electronic devices, including smartphones, remote controls, and other consumer electronics that predominantly utilize alkaline batteries for their operations. Furthermore, advancements in battery technology and the continuous efforts of manufacturers to improve energy density and longevity are anticipated to significantly boost market expansion. Additionally, the growing trend of eco-friendly and sustainable battery production is expected to play a crucial role in shaping the market landscape. The expansion of e-commerce channels is further likely to enhance product accessibility, thus fostering market growth.

By Product Type

AA:

AA batteries are one of the most popular choices in the primary alkaline batteries segment, accounting for a significant share of the market. Their widespread use in household items such as remote controls, toys, and portable devices has made them a staple in many households. The versatility of AA batteries enables them to cater to both high-drain and low-drain devices, making them an attractive choice for consumers. Furthermore, the growing trend towards energy-efficient devices that require reliable power sources has bolstered the demand for AA batteries. As manufacturers continue to innovate and enhance the performance of AA alkaline batteries, their market presence is expected to remain strong, driving overall growth in this segment.

AAA:

AAA batteries, being smaller than AA batteries, are predominantly used in compact devices that require a smaller power source. These include remote controls, cameras, and various portable electronics. The growing trend of miniaturization in technology has led to an increase in the demand for AAA alkaline batteries, as multiple devices shift towards utilizing these batteries for their efficiency and lightweight characteristics. Furthermore, advancements in battery chemistry have allowed for improved energy capacity in AAA batteries, making them more appealing for consumers. With a steady rise in the adoption of battery-operated gadgets, the AAA battery segment is witnessing significant growth, contributing to the overall expansion of the primary alkaline batteries market.

C:

C batteries are typically utilized in larger devices that require a larger power output, such as flashlights, toys, and portable radios. Although not as commonly used as AA or AAA batteries, C batteries still hold a valuable position in the market due to their unique applications. The industrial and entertainment sectors have been primary consumers of C batteries, as devices in these fields often require longer-lasting and more robust power sources. With the ongoing demand for battery-operated equipment and an increase in outdoor activities that rely on portable power, the C battery segment is expected to grow steadily, reflecting its importance in the overall primary alkaline batteries market.

D:

D batteries are recognized for their capability to deliver a high amount of current, making them ideal for heavy-duty applications such as large toys, portable lighting, and emergency equipment. Their relatively long lifespan and robust design make them suitable for devices that demand consistent power over extended periods. The demand for D batteries is primarily driven by sectors that utilize high-drain equipment, such as professional audio equipment and larger consumer electronics. As the trend towards outdoor and recreational activities continues to rise, the need for reliable power sources like D batteries is expected to increase, further solidifying their position in the primary alkaline batteries market.

9V:

The 9V battery segment plays a crucial role in powering devices that require a higher voltage output. These batteries are commonly used in smoke detectors, musical instruments, and portable medical devices. The demand for 9V alkaline batteries is fueled by increasing safety regulations surrounding smoke detectors, as they are essential for home safety. Additionally, innovations in electronic devices that require compact battery solutions have further spurred the growth of the 9V segment. With ongoing advancements in technology and an emphasis on safety, the 9V battery market is expected to grow, showcasing its importance within the overall primary alkaline batteries market structure.

By Region

The North American primary alkaline batteries market is projected to maintain its leadership position, driven by the high demand for consumer electronics and the increasing reliance on portable power sources. The region accounted for approximately 30% of the global market share in 2023, with a growing CAGR of 4.5% anticipated through 2035. Factors contributing to this growth include the presence of major battery manufacturers, a robust retail network, and a growing awareness of environmentally friendly battery solutions. Furthermore, the continued expansion of online shopping platforms in North America is expected to enhance the accessibility of alkaline batteries, supporting overall market growth.

In Europe, the primary alkaline batteries market is also witnessing significant growth, fueled by a rise in the use of battery-operated devices in various applications, including consumer electronics and industrial equipment. Europe accounted for around 25% of the global market share in 2023, with an expected CAGR of 3.8% during the forecast period. The region's commitment to sustainability and the development of eco-friendly battery technologies are expected to play a crucial role in shaping the future of the market. Additionally, growing regulations surrounding battery disposal and recycling are anticipated to further enhance the market landscape in Europe as consumers become more environmentally conscious.

Threats

One significant threat to the primary alkaline batteries market is the increasing competition from alternative power sources, such as lithium-ion and rechargeable batteries. As technology advances, rechargeable batteries have become more efficient, offering longer life spans and lower long-term costs to consumers. This shift towards rechargeable solutions poses a serious challenge to the traditional alkaline battery market, particularly among environmentally conscious consumers looking to reduce waste. Furthermore, the initial cost of rechargeable batteries has decreased significantly, making them more accessible and appealing to a broader audience. As a result, the primary alkaline batteries market must strategize and innovate to retain its relevance amidst this growing competition and changing consumer preferences.

Another potential threat to the market is the tightening regulatory environment surrounding battery production and disposal. Governments and regulatory bodies around the world are increasingly implementing stringent rules aimed at reducing the environmental impact of batteries. This includes regulations regarding the use of hazardous materials, battery recycling, and proper disposal methods. Such regulations can create challenges for manufacturers in terms of compliance and operational costs. Companies that fail to adapt to these regulations may face reputational and financial risks, potentially impacting their market position. Addressing these regulatory challenges through sustainable practices and innovation will be imperative for businesses looking to thrive in the primary alkaline batteries market.
